Mailbox repair services involve fixing and restoring mail receptacles that have become damaged, worn, or non-functional. Over time, mailboxes can experience issues such as rust, cracks, dents, or broken parts that prevent them from securely holding mail or functioning properly. Repair services may include replacing damaged components, reinforcing structural elements, realigning the mailbox, or sealing cracks to prevent further deterioration. These repairs help ensure that mail is protected and that the mailbox remains secure and visually appealing.
Many common problems that mailbox repair services address include rust corrosion, bent or broken doors, loose or missing hardware, and damaged posts or mounting brackets. Sometimes, mailboxes are affected by weather conditions, such as strong winds or heavy rain, which can cause them to become unstable or dislodged. Other times, mailboxes sustain accidental damage from vehicles or vandalism. Repairing these issues can prevent further damage, avoid the need for complete replacement, and maintain the overall functionality and appearance of the property.

The overview below groups typical Mailbox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in North Charleston, SC.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Most minor mailbox repairs, such as fixing hinges or replacing a lock, typically cost between $50 and $150. These projects are common and usually fall within this lower to mid-range. Larger or more complex repairs tend to be less frequent in this tier.
Moderate Fixes - Replacing a mailbox post or repairing minor structural damage generally costs between $150 and $400. Many routine repairs land in this middle band, with fewer projects reaching higher amounts.
Full Replacement - Installing a new mailbox or replacing an entire mailbox assembly can range from $200 to $600. Local contractors often handle these moderate projects within this range, though premium materials or custom designs can increase costs.
Large or Custom Projects - Larger, more complex mailbox repairs or custom installations can cost $600 and up, with some projects exceeding $1,000. These higher-end jobs are less common but are handled by specialists for unique or extensive need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
